SK12 1DB is a sought-after residential area on Redacre, 1.0km from Woodside in Poynton. Administratively it sits within Poynton East and Pott Shrigley ward and the Macclesfield constituency.

One of the more sought-after postcodes in SK12, SK12 1DB offers a family-oriented neighbourhood with a mix of housing types. This is a settled, family-oriented neighbourhood (average age 50) — stable, lower-turnover, predominantly owner-occupied. 95%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.

Safety: Crime rates are low here at 13 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Prices average £840k. The area ranks among the least deprived 20% in England — a strong signal of community wellbeing, good schools, and low crime.

Census 2021 statistics for SK12 1DB are sourced from Output Area E00094160 (shared with 12 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
